Understanding Double Glazing
Double glazing involves using 2 panes of glass with an area in between, which is typically filled with an inert gas such as argon, krypton, or xenon. This building and construction considerably decreases heat loss compared to single-pane windows. Additionally, double glazing also supplies sound insulation, increases security, and can elevate the total aesthetic appeal of a home.

New developments in double glazing innovation are continuously making it more effective. Below are a few of the significant advancements:
TechnologyDescriptionLow-E GlassLow-emissivity coverings reduce heat transfer while optimizing light entry.Triple Glazing3 panes of glass deal even higher insulation, ideal for severe climates.Smart GlazingModifications openness based upon temperature or electric stimuli, enabling adjustable light and heat management.Gas-Filled SpacesUsage of inert gases such as argon or krypton enhances thermal insulation by minimizing convection within the unit.Warm Edge Spacer BarsMade from insulating materials, these bars lessen heat transfer compared to conventional aluminum spacers.Choosing New Double Glazing
